Gamma Communications complete transition from AIM to the Main Market of the LSE
May 2025
Gamma Communications is a leading supplier of communication services in the UK, German, Spanish and Dutch business markets. It was admitted to trading on AIM in 2014 and employs approximately 1,900 people. With a range of UCaaS, mobile and connectivity services, Gamma provides robust and secure solutions that enable organisations to communicate, collaborate and offer a better customer experience.
Its largest market is in the UK where the company’s network-based services are supplied to SME, Public Sector and Enterprise markets through a network of 3000+ channel partners and its own direct sales and support capabilities. Gamma is expanding its UCaaS presence in Europe with a suite of businesses focusing on digital automation, delivering Gamma-powered services to SME customers via a network of channel partners.
The Company’s vision is for a better-connected world in which they can work smarter for the benefit of business, people, and the planet by developing a strong and sustainable pan-European product set, building a leading position in the UCaaS and CCaaS markets.
Following the acquisition of Coolwave Communications in February 2024, Gamma is now able to offer communications services fully compliant with local telecommunications regulations in around 20 countries.
Admission to the Main Market of the LSE
On 2nd May 2025, the admission to listing in the equity shares (Commercial Companies) category of the Official List and to trading on the Main Market of the London Stock Exchange commenced.
